Sound travels nearly five times faster in water than in air, allowing whale calls to carry across vast distances.
Low-frequency engine noise from commercial vessels overlaps with the frequency range used by Balaenoptera borealis, potentially masking communication signals.

Chronic acoustic disturbance can disrupt mating displays, mother-calf contact, and navigation across migratory routes.
Researchers use passive acoustic monitoring to assess how increasing industrial activity affects whale behavior in offshore environments.
